Infiniti J30 problems by year
Owners have filed 84 safety complaints with NHTSA about the Infiniti J30 across model years 1992 to 2006. Three years stand out: 1993 for air bags complaints, 1994 for air bags complaints and 1995 for visibility complaints. The quietest years are 2000, 2001 and 1992.

How to read this page
Every figure comes from the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ration's public complaint database, which holds every safety-related defect complaint filed by owners since 1995. We refresh it monthly and count each complaint once per component it names. Data through September 6, 2026.
NHTSA only accepts safety-related complaints. Rattles, paint, infotainment bugs and other annoyances are under-reported here, so this page is a map of what fails in ways owners consider dangerous, not a full reliability score.
Counts are raw. Use the year-over-year shape and the component mix, not the absolute numbers. Common questions
Which Infiniti J30 years have the most problems?
By NHTSA complaint volume, 1993, 1994, 1995 carry the most filings on the Infiniti J30. The 1993 alone has 24 complaints, led by air bags.
What is the most common Infiniti J30 problem?
On the 1993 model year, the most-reported component is air bags with 7 complaints. The table above lists the top components for every year.
At what mileage do Infiniti J30 problems start?
The median mileage at failure across all Infiniti J30 complaints that include mileage is about 107,000 miles. Older model years skew higher; the per-year figure is in the "at a glance" card.
Are these complaints verified?
No. NHTSA publishes complaints as submitted and does not investigate individual filings. Patterns across hundreds of complaints are meaningful; a single one is not.
